Commit bf056d9b by wutong

修复订单号太短, 截取索引越界问题

parent 9aaba26a
...@@ -448,10 +448,12 @@ public class OrderSyncJob extends PointJob { ...@@ -448,10 +448,12 @@ public class OrderSyncJob extends PointJob {
} }
private void hasInnerSale(OmsResult omsResult, DcBaseOmsOrder dcBaseOmsOrder) { private void hasInnerSale(OmsResult omsResult, DcBaseOmsOrder dcBaseOmsOrder) {
String substring = omsResult.getOriginOrderId().substring(0, 6); if (omsResult.getOriginOrderId().length() > 6) {
dcBaseOmsOrder.setHasInnersale(false); String substring = omsResult.getOriginOrderId().substring(0, 6);
if (substring.toLowerCase().equals("neigou")) { dcBaseOmsOrder.setHasInnersale(false);
dcBaseOmsOrder.setHasInnersale(true); if (substring.toLowerCase().equals("neigou")) {
dcBaseOmsOrder.setHasInnersale(true);
}
} }
} }
......
...@@ -9,7 +9,7 @@ EVENT_RDB_STORAGE_USERNAME=root ...@@ -9,7 +9,7 @@ EVENT_RDB_STORAGE_USERNAME=root
EVENT_RDB_STORAGE_PASSWORD=#7kfnymAM$Y9-Ntf EVENT_RDB_STORAGE_PASSWORD=#7kfnymAM$Y9-Ntf
ZOOKEEPER_SERVER=172.31.255.120:2181 ZOOKEEPER_SERVER=172.31.255.120:2181
NAME_SPACE=data-center NAME_SPACE=data-center
#JOB_NAME=base-sync-oms-order-coroutine JOB_NAME=base-sync-oms-order-coroutine
JOB_NAME=base-sync-oms-order #JOB_NAME=base-sync-oms-order
JOB_CRON=0/1 * * * * ? * JOB_CRON=0/1 * * * * ? *
SHARDING_TOTAL_COUNT=1 SHARDING_TOTAL_COUNT=1
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ment